Boundary Wire

A perimeter wire, also known as a boundary cable, outlines the mowing spot for robotic mowers. Usually related at a single close to an AC-powered base station that serves various features - like charging them when docked - the opposite conclude is usually put alongside the edge of your lawn and staked down; creating an invisible magnetic discipline which retains the robotic in just your yard although sending indicators as a result of this wire that let it know you need it not to go away its specified boundaries.

Most mowers that make the most of this know-how occur Geared up which has a package especially for setting up boundary wire and charging stations, Although some even present Experienced set up of both equally.

GPS

GPS systems may be a superb addition to robotic lawn mowers, Specifically with regards to theft deterrence. However, on the other hand, they may put up with atmospheric distortion, sign reflection together with other troubles like staying blocked from observing satellites on account of trees/walls (comparable to what comes about with the cell phone sign).

Suppliers ever more use RTK on robot garden mowers, enabling them to work regardless if there isn't a direct line-of-sight with GPS satellites. To achieve this, a base station Geared up with an extra GPS receiver provides corrections which can then be in comparison towards the sign obtained within the mower by itself.

Garden you can try here mowers like lawn care services lincoln ne use this data to pinpoint their position and navigate by their mowing region extra precisely and reliably than only depending on GPS on your own.

Some mowers integrate RTK systems right into their foundation, while for Other folks you should purchase an upgrade kit to include a person.
